The Quant Network team developed Quant as a cryptocurrency token based on the Ethereum blockchain. The solutions offered by Quant include Overledger OS and GoVerify.
According to the whitepaper, the initial goals of the Overledger project were to develop an interface to connect the world’s networks to multiple blockchains, bridge existing networks to new blockchains, and to develop a blockchain operating system with a protocol and platform that allows developers to create next-generation multi-chain applications.
Their proposition for GoVerify is to allow people to verify and check whether any emails, SMS, mail, or phone calls received appear as legitimate and actually from the stated sender.

transfer keyboard_arrow_up
Requirements help
Source Code
function transfer(address _to, uint256 _value) public returns (bool) {
require(_to != address(0));
require(_value <= balances[msg.sender]);
// SafeMath.sub will throw if there is not enough balance.
balances[msg.sender] = balances[msg.sender].sub(_value);
balances[_to] = balances[_to].add(_value);
emit Transfer(msg.sender, _to, _value);
return true;
}

transferFrom keyboard_arrow_up
Requirements help
Source Code
function transferFrom(address _from, address _to, uint256 _value) public returns (bool) {
require(_to != address(0));
require(_value <= balances[_from]);
require(_value <= allowed[_from][msg.sender]);
balances[_from] = balances[_from].sub(_value);
balances[_to] = balances[_to].add(_value);
allowed[_from][msg.sender] = allowed[_from][msg.sender].sub(_value);
emit Transfer(_from, _to, _value);
return true;
}

decreaseApproval keyboard_arrow_up
Source Code
function decreaseApproval(address _spender, uint _subtractedValue) public returns (bool) {
uint oldValue = allowed[msg.sender][_spender];
if (_subtractedValue > oldValue) {
allowed[msg.sender][_spender] = 0;
} else {
allowed[msg.sender][_spender] = oldValue.sub(_subtractedValue);
}
emit Approval(msg.sender, _spender, allowed[msg.sender][_spender]);
return true;
}
